DOS Times Vol. 12, No. 10 April, 2007 Congenital nasolacrimal duct obstruction is the most common cause of epiphora in children. In the majority of cases, it is due to an obstruction at the lower end of the NLD. Background: Obstruction of the nasolacrimal duct is the most common abnormality of the lacrimal system in childhood leading to epiphora. It is found in about 20% of newborns. If not treated in time, it may be complicated by recurrent conjunctivitis, chronic dacryocystitis, and lacrimal abscess formation.
